About

Karingal St Laurence Limited is a registered charity based in Highton, VIC. Its purposes include social welfare. It serves: aged, chronic illness, disability, unemployed.

genU Commercial & Corporate Training logo

It's good for you and good for your community. genU Training is a National not-for-profit that invests its surplus back into the community. We call it 'profit for purpose', so when you study with us, not only will you benefit, but you'll also be helping others in your community.
